An extremely well preserved Heer dress dagger, measuring 40 cm in total length when inserted into the scabbard. It features a 26 cm long nickel plated magnetic steel blade with a sharpened tip and edges. The blade is plain with the exception of a makers mark on the reverse ricasso reading F. W.
